Section courante

A propos

Section administrative du site

LOCAL

Local
Turbo Basic

Syntaxe

LOCAL variable,variable,...

Paramètres

Nom Description
variable Ce paramètre permet d'indiquer la variable locale

Description

Cette commande permet de définir des variables seulement utilisable localement dans une fonction ou un sous-programme (procédure).

Remarques

Exemple

Voici un exemple montrant l'utilisation de cette fonction :

  1. a = 1
  2. b = 2
  3.  
  4. Sub Func1
  5.  LOCAL a
  6.  a = 2
  7.  b = 27
  8.  PRINT "Func1, variable a = "; a
  9.  PRINT "Func1, variable b = "; b
  10. End Sub
  11.  
  12. PRINT "a = "; a
  13. PRINT "b = "; b
  14. INCR a,10
  15. CALL Func1
  16. PRINT "a = "; a
  17. PRINT "b = "; b

on obtiendra le résultat suivant :

a = 1
b = 2
Func1, variable a = 2
Func1, variable b = 27
a = 11
b = 2

Références

INFOGUIDE - Turbo Basic, Editions P.S.I., Bénédicte Hudault, 1988, ISBN: 2-86595-531-1, page 76

Dernière mise à jour : Mardi, le 28 juillet 2015